The first measurement of the inclusive cross-section of the Z boson decaying to two tau leptons was measured with the ATLAS detector at the LHC. The data sample in this analysis represents an integrated luminosity of 35 pb ̄1 of proton-proton collisions at a center of mass energy of sqrt(s)=7 TeV. Separate measurements were performed in four decay modes based on how the two tau leptons decay: to hadrons and an electron, to hadrons and a muon, to an electron and a muon, and to two muons. In all four final states, inclusive cross-section measurements were made both in the fiducial region of the ATLAS detector where acceptance is high and in the full phase space, restricted to the mass range of [66, 116] GeV. The measurements from the four individual channels were then combined to yield the combined Z --> [tau] [tau] cross-section of 970 ± 70 (stat.) ± 60 (sys.) ± 30 (lumi.) pb.

The ZZ production cross section in proton-proton collisions at 13 TeV center-of-mass energy is measured using 3.2 fb–1 of data recorded with the ATLAS detector at the Large Hadron Collider. The considered Z boson candidates decay to an electron or muon pair of mass 66–116 GeV. The cross section is measured in a fiducial phase space reflecting the detector acceptance. It is also extrapolated to a total phase space for Z bosons in the same mass range and of all decay modes, giving 16.7+2.2–2.0(stat)+0.9–0.7(syst)+1.0–0.7(lumi) pb. Lastly, the results agree with standard model predictions.

Double-differential three-jet production cross-sections are measured in proton-proton collisions at a centre-of-mass energy of [arrow]" = 7TeV using the ATLAS detector at the large hadron collider. The measurements are presented as a function of the three-jet mass (mjjj), in bins of the sum of the absolute rapidity separations between the three leading jets).

Abstract: A measurement of ZZ production in the 4l channel with pp collisions at sqrt(s)=8 TeV using the full 2012 dataset amounting to an integrated luminosity of 20 fb-1 collected by the ATLAS experiment is presented in this paper. An event is selected when exactly four reconstructed, isolated leptons are found in the final state. Each pair of leptons reconstructed to form a Z boson must have opposite sign and same flavor and have an invariant mass between 66 and 116 GeV. The background contribution is determined using a data-driven technique due to limited Monte Carlo statistics. Limits on the f_4^gamma, f_4^Z,f_5^gamma, f_5^Z anomalous triple gauge couplings are also presented.

Here, the production of W±Z events in proton-proton collisions at a centre-of-mass energy of 13 TeV13 TeV is measured with the ATLAS detector at the LHC. The collected data correspond to an integrated luminosity of 3.2 fb-1. The W±Z candidates are reconstructed using leptonic decays of the gauge bosons into electrons or muons.
